While the ice maker is functioning, an arm extends away from the ice maker over the ice cube bin. During each ice making cycle, the arm rises up and then drops back down after the new ice is dumped into the ice cube bin. As ice accumulates in the bin it prevents the arm from dropping back down. When the arm is high enough, the ice maker shuts off and no more ice is made until the ice level in the bin drops.
The ice maker can also be turned off manually by lifting the arm all the way up into a locked position. The arm is supported at one or both ends. One end extends into the back of the front support. If it is not securely in place, it could cause the ice maker to malfunction. Confirm that the arm is securely in place.
For proper operation, confirm that arm is in the lowered position and that nothing is blocking it from normal movement.
To test the shutoff function, lift the arm up into the manual shutoff position. Recheck the unit later to confirm that no ice is being made.
